Abstract
The invention discloses a kind of interior architecture construction cooling and dedusting device, including base, refrigeration case is provided with the left of the base top, cooling dust cleaning case is provided with the right side of the base top, at cooling dust cleaning case top center escape pipe is rotatably connected to by rolling bearing units, gear is installed on escape pipe, the escape pipe bottom is passed through at the top of cooling dust cleaning case, escape pipe bottom is provided with blower fan, slide rail is additionally provided with the top of the cooling dust cleaning case, rack is slidably connected by sliding block above slide rail, rack and pinion engages, reducing motor is also provided with by support plate at the top of the cooling dust cleaning case left side wall, reducing motor top motor shaft is connected with rotating disk, rotating disk top right side is fixedly installed bearing pin, bearing pin is rotatably connected to connecting rod, connecting rod right-hand member is hinged with rack left end.The present invention rotates escape pipe by rotating disk and swung so that outlet angle constantly changes, and cold air one way or another sprays, and accelerates cooling rate, improves cooling-down effect.

The present invention operation principle be:When summer, temperature was higher, if construction point is not powered on, device is moved to room
Interior construction point, ice cube and water are added into refrigeration case 3, water height is more than the height of the second outlet pipe 25 so that the water in refrigeration case 3
It can enter in cooling dust cleaning case 24, start blower fan 23, the cold air cylinder escape pipe 20 to cool in dust cleaning case 24 is discharged;Start simultaneously
Reducing motor 14, reducing motor 14 drive rotating disk 15 to rotate, and rotating disk 15 drives bearing pin 16 to rotate, and bearing pin 16 passes through the band of fixed pulley 13
Dynamic baffle plate 9 moves, and drawstring 12 coordinates with extension spring 8 so that baffle plate 9 moves up and down, and baffle plate 9 is by piston rod 7 with piston 6
Move up and down, when piston 6 moves up, air pressure reduces in pressurized cylinder 5, and the water to cool in dust cleaning case 24 is entered by water inlet pipe 10
Enter in pressurized cylinder 5, when piston 6 moves down, the water in pressurized cylinder 5 is entered under the pressure of piston 6 by the first outlet pipe 4 to be made
In ice chest 3, so as to carry out water circulation, temperature exchange is completed;Bearing pin 16 rotates simultaneously, and bearing pin 16 is by connecting rod 17 with carry-over bar 19
Move left and right, rack 19 drives escape pipe 20 to swing with the positive and negative rotation of moving gear 21, gear 21 so that cold air range of scatter becomes
Extensively, room temperature lowering is accelerated;Start air exhauster 27, the updraft of air exhauster 27 simultaneously, dust enters cooling dedusting by U-tube 26
In case 24, dust is incorporated in water, and the water to cool in dust cleaning case 24 during water inlet pipe 10 by filter cartridge 30 by filtering, while exhausting
Hot-air is pumped into the cooling inner bottom part of dust cleaning case 24 by machine 27, is cooled through water in the dust cleaning case 24 that cools, air exhauster 27 be evacuated also
The cooling inside and outside air pressure balance of dust cleaning case 24 can be kept.Cool after the completion of dedusting, close reducing motor 14, blower fan 23 and air exhauster
27, filter cartridge 30 is removed dust mixture therein is handled.
